The Virtual Event Experience
Virtual events leverage online platforms and advanced technologies to recreate the experience of traditional conferences and exhibitions in a virtual environment. Attendees can participate from anywhere, eliminating the need for travel and accommodation expenses. These events offer interactive features such as live presentations, panel discussions, networking opportunities, and virtual booths for exhibitors.
Benefits of Virtual Events
a. Accessibility and Reach: Virtual events break down geographical barriers, allowing participants from around the world to attend without the constraints of time and travel. This expands the reach of conferences and exhibitions, enabling a more diverse and global audience.
b. Cost-Effectiveness: Virtual events significantly reduce costs associated with venue rentals, logistics, and travel expenses. This makes them more affordable for both organizers and attendees, opening up opportunities for small businesses and startups to participate and exhibit.
c. Flexibility and Convenience: Attendees have the flexibility to access event content at their convenience, as virtual events often provide on-demand access to recorded sessions. This accommodates different time zones and allows participants to engage at their own pace.
d. Environmental Sustainability: By eliminating the need for physical infrastructure and reducing carbon emissions from travel, virtual events contribute to a more sustainable and eco-friendly approach to conferences and exhibitions.

Navigating the Virtual Event Space
a. Enhanced Networking: Virtual events provide networking opportunities through dedicated chat rooms, video meetings, and matchmaking algorithms that connect attendees with shared interests. These features foster connections and collaboration, albeit in a digital space.
b. Interactive Exhibitor Booths: Exhibitors can showcase their products and services through virtual booths equipped with multimedia content, live demos, and chat capabilities. Attendees can engage directly with exhibitors, gather information, and make inquiries, simulating the experience of browsing physical booths.
c. Seamless Event Management: Organizers utilize event management platforms to streamline registration, content management, and attendee engagement. These platforms provide analytics and data insights that help optimize future events.
The Future of Virtual Events
As technology continues to advance, virtual events are expected to become even more immersive and interactive. Hybrid events, combining virtual and physical components, are also gaining traction, allowing for a blended experience that caters to both on-site and remote participants.
